They are doing FULL build sites first for LTE... The mall is the cut off point for full builds for now. Yes Canandaigua, Dansville, Palmyra, Newark etc are full builds.  

 

You cannot definitely state that they are not doing full build sites unless you are present at every cell site and confirm it.

 

Schedule changes have occurred and GMOs were planned due to ROI and lack of funds back during the planning stages of 2011-2012. The purchase and billions of investment by Softbank has changed everything up and most former planned GMOs are now full builds.

 

GMOs are now only reserved for sites with extraneous reasons and not the norm. By virtue of being a late 2013 4th round market it's more likely than not that former planned GMOs are full builds.
